"I worked for Power Home Remodeling for nearly two years in a multitude of capacities. I worked in both lead generation in residential and retail environments, as well as in-home project sales. The best part about working for Power is the culture and camaraderie shared by the employees, everyone around you genuinely wants you to excel and be the best version of yourself. Compensation and benefits are comprehensive and well above average. Certain positions are salary plus commission, some are commission only. The commission is uncapped and increases exponentially with performance due to bonuses. Upper management is very sharp and has a good relationship with employees of all tenures. The company vision is very lucid and admirable, and all employees share the same goals. A great example of how much upper management cares is the yearly paid vacation to Cancun for all employees, regardless of performance or position. The only downside about working for Power is that opportunities are limited at certain offices across the country. Specifically in Florida this is due to building code, and means that the office in Florida is more limited in products, which in turn reduces earning potential for sales reps and limits opportunity for advancement locally. Sales for Power is a very difficult but extremely rewarding position and I would recommend it to both friends and family."
